Two teenagers have been charged with the murder of a Norfolk 18-year-old who was stabbed to death in Ipswich town centre.

Raymond James Quigley, known as James, from Wymondham died after the attack in Westgate Street last Tuesday afternoon.

A murder probe was subsequently launched and police said they were looking for two suspects.

On Saturday evening, police confirmed two people, a 17-year-old boy and and 18-year-old man, had been arrested on suspicion of murder and attempted murder.

On Monday evening, Suffolk police confirmed Alfie Hammett, 18 and of Rushmere St Andrew, had been charged with murder and possession of an offensive weapon in a public place.

A 17-year-old boy from Ipswich, who cannot be named for legal reasons, has also been charged with murder and possession of an offensive weapon in a public place.

The pair will appear before Suffolk Magistrates' Court on Tuesday.
